Python视角:ASP架构解析与安全调试
|
在当今的Web开发环境中,ASP(Active Server Pages)架构虽然已经逐渐被更现代的技术所取代,但它仍然是许多遗留系统的核心组成部分。作为云架构站长,我深知理解这些传统技术的重要性,尤其是在进行安全调试时。 从Python的视角来看,ASP的执行机制与现代框架如Django或Flask有着显著的不同。ASP依赖于服务器端的脚本语言,通常是VBScript或JScript,而Python则通过解释器直接处理请求。这种差异意味着在调试ASP应用时,需要关注不同的日志和错误信息源。 安全问题是ASP架构中不可忽视的部分。由于其早期的设计理念,很多ASP应用存在潜在的安全漏洞,例如SQL注入、跨站脚本攻击等。Python可以作为辅助工具,用于自动化扫描这些漏洞,或者通过编写脚本来模拟攻击行为,帮助识别系统中的薄弱点。 在实际操作中,使用Python进行ASP的安全调试,通常需要结合一些第三方库,如requests和BeautifulSoup,来模拟用户请求并分析响应内容。同时,利用Python的正则表达式功能,可以快速定位可能的代码注入点。
2026AI生成内容,仅供参考 对于云架构而言,ASP应用的迁移或改造是一个复杂的过程。Python在这一过程中可以发挥重要作用,例如通过脚本自动化处理配置文件、生成文档或进行数据迁移。同时,确保迁移后的系统具备良好的安全性也是关键。 站长个人见解,尽管ASP架构已经不是主流,但在维护和调试现有系统时,仍然需要深入理解其工作原理。Python作为一种灵活且强大的编程语言,能够为这一过程提供有力支持,特别是在安全性和自动化方面。 (编辑:52站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

